Key Responsibilities

1. Food Safety & Operations

  • Supervise food prep and service activities
  • Enforce hygiene and sanitation standards
  • Ensure safe food temperatures and storage
  • Maintain equipment and report issues
  • Keep kitchen and dining areas clean

2. Staff Management

  • Schedule shifts and assign duties
  • Train, support, and monitor staff
  • Resolve staff issues and feedback
  • Ensure team performance and discipline
  • Keep proper staffing during peak hours

3. Inventory & Records

  • Manage stock levels and supply orders
  • Track inventory usage and reduce waste
  • Maintain expense and sales reports
  • Use basic tools for scheduling and logs
  • Record daily activity summaries
